Description
A warm and comforting ginger tea that’s easy to make and perfect for chilly evenings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2-inch piece of fresh ginger, peeled and sliced
- 4 cups of water
- Honey, to taste
- Fresh lemon juice, to taste
Instructions
- Boil 4 cups of water in a medium saucepan.
- While the water heats, peel and thinly slice your fresh ginger.
- Once the water reaches a rolling boil, add the ginger. Reduce the heat and let it simmer for 10-15 minutes.
- Remove the pot from heat, strain the ginger pieces, and pour into teacups.
- Add honey and lemon juice to taste, stir well, and enjoy!
Notes
For a deeper flavor, roast the ginger before adding it to the water. Avoid using dried ginger for the best taste.
